Job Description
Nature of Work:
The IT Coordinator plays a vital role in supporting and coordinating information technology systems across 3Rivers' merged agencies. This position ensures the alignment of technology, data, and operations to enhance the delivery of high-quality, person-centered services. Serving as the primary liaison between the organization's leadership, staff, and managed IT service provider, the IT Coordinator translates technical concepts into practical, user-focused solutions that support daily operations and organizational goals. This position requires strict adherence to HIPAA privacy and security regulations. The IT Coordinator is responsible for maintaining confidentiality, integrity, and availability of protected health information (PHI) through secure system management, staff education, and collaboration with vendors. The coordinator models and enforces 3Rivers' commitment to ethical data stewardship and compliance with all applicable state and federal privacy laws.
Essential Functions:
System Integration and Management . Coordinate with external IT vendors to implement and maintain secure, functional, and user-friendly systems. Manage timelines, deliverables, and communication throughout integration projects. Oversee hardware, software, and network connectivity to ensure operational efficiency. Technical Oversight and Support Serve as the point of contact for all IT-related vendors and service providers. Ensure prompt response and resolution to IT-related issues. Oversee upgrades, security patches, and system maintenance. Ensure compliance with HIPAA, cybersecurity, and data privacy standards. Training, Access, and User Support Coordinate user setup, access, and removal across systems including Office 365, shared drives, and specialized applications. Provide technical support and troubleshooting for agency staff. Develop and maintain user-friendly guides and standard operating procedures. Conduct new-hire and ongoing technology training focused on secure and compliant system use. Inventory, Procurement, and Documentation Maintain detailed inventory of all IT equipment, hardware, and software licenses. Maintain accurate documentation of network configurations, system updates, and integrations. Business Continuity and Security Support implementation of 3Rivers' Business Continuity and Disaster Recovery Plans. Participate in annual technology audits and security reviews.

Qualifications:
Bachelor's degree required in information technology, computer science, or related field preferred. Proven experience in IT system integration, preferably in a multi-agency or multi-service environment. Proven ability to communicate effectively with technical and non-technical stakeholders. Strong knowledge of system architecture, data management, and cybersecurity. Experience working in HIPAA regulated or healthcare/human services environments. Excellent project management skills with a successful project delivery track record. Strong understanding of service delivery systems for individuals with intellectual and developmental disabilities. Experience with regulatory oversight, compliance (including MaineCare services), and quality improvement. Excellent written and verbal communication skills, including the ability to communicate effectively with stakeholders at all levels. High proficiency in Microsoft Office 365 applications and comfort with data systems and electronic documentation platforms. Valid and insurable Maine driver's license required. Ability to pass required background checks, to include: Adult/Child Protective Services; criminal history; OIG Exclusion list; National Sex Offender Registry; Bureau of Motor Vehicles record; and Maine CNA Registry.
